Abstract

It is shown that the linear AC-conductance of a one-dimensional Luttinger liquid factorizes into parts which depend on the internal properties, and the external probe field. For strong and long-range interaction, there is a resonance due to charge waves. It can be used to define a quantum capacitance and a quantum inductance.
